Not every wine is worth buying. The Wine Pair Podcast features a married couple as they try wines they haven't had before, share their brutally honest opinions, and tell you which bottles are worth your money. Each week, Joe and Carmela take on a different grape, wine style, or region, then taste two or three reasonably priced bottles, usually under $25, and describe what they are tasting in ways that are hilarious and actually make sense. Some are great, some are fine, and some absolutely are not worth buying. From Chardonnay and Pinot Noir to grapes you may never have heard of, the show combines useful wine education in plain language, food pairings, affordable recommendations, and the natural chemistry of two people who know each other well enough to disagree. A lot. Joe and Carmela purchase the wines featured in their regular review episodes and do not accept free samples for review, so the opinions and ratings are entirely their own.
